WebDec 6, 2024 · The core of the pseudo-random generator is the InternalSample() (line #100) method which constructs the sequence of numbers. Random.nextDouble() will actually call the Sample() method which returns the value of InternalSample() divided by Int32.MaxValue, as this is claimed to improve the distribution of random numbers. WebMar 29, 2024 · An RNG that is suitable for cryptographic usage is called a Cryptographically Secure Pseudo-Random Number Generator (CSPRNG). The strength of a cryptographic system depends heavily on the properties of these CSPRNGs. Depending on how the generated pseudo-random data is applied, a CSPRNG might need to exhibit …

I'm not sure what algorithm is used to generate Unity's random numbers, but C#'s Random class is, according to the documentation, using an algorithm based on a modified version of Donald E. Knuth's subtractive random number generator algorithm.
